  • CLM adoption is a business transformation, not a system rollout.
    It requires aligning stakeholders, processes, and technology to ensure contracts are actively used across functions.
  • Stakeholder-centric design drives adoption success.
    Mapping pain points across legal, procurement, sales, finance, and IT ensures the system delivers immediate and relevant value.
  • Clear business outcomes accelerate buy-in.
    Linking CLM to revenue, compliance, and cost savings helps stakeholders understand its impact beyond operations.
  • Phased rollout reduces resistance and builds momentum.
    Starting with high-volume contracts and scaling through proven success enables smoother enterprise-wide adoption.
  • Integration is critical to sustained usage.
    Connecting CLM with CRM, ERP, and procurement systems eliminates friction and embeds contracts into daily workflows.
  • Continuous governance ensures long-term value.
    Tracking adoption metrics, refining workflows, and incorporating feedback keeps the system relevant and trusted.
  • Enterprise CLM platforms operationalize adoption at scale.
    With automation, analytics, and integrations, CLM becomes a control layer that drives efficiency, compliance, and performance across the lifecycle.
List departments impacted by contracts—legal, procurement, sales, finance, IT, and executives—and use interviews to identify influencers.
Use two-way communication: listen to pain points, then demonstrate improvements through pilot results and measurable benefits using tools like Sirion.
Highlight quick wins such as reduced cycle times, improved compliance tracking, and visible ROI enabled by Sirion's analytics.
Monitor adoption rates, login frequency, cycle times, renewal capture, and satisfaction scores to measure engagement across roles.
Pilots allow teams to refine processes, confirm value, and build internal champions before scaling Sirion’s CLM across the enterprise.
